The Kenyan Shilling (KES), the official currency of Kenya, represents more than just a financial medium for transactions. It is a symbol of the nation's economic independence, sovereignty, and rich cultural heritage. Introduced in 1966, the Kenyan Shilling replaced the East African Shilling, marking a significant milestone in Kenya's post-colonial economic journey. Commonly abbreviated as KES and represented by the symbol KSh, the currency embodies the country's economic challenges and aspirations, serving as a crucial indicator of the nation's financial pulse.

In everyday life, the Kenyan Shilling is the backbone of the country's economic activities. It is used for wages, prices, and services, facilitating trade in key sectors such as agriculture, tourism, manufacturing, and services. The currency's stability and value directly impact the economic growth and the well-being of Kenyan citizens. Moreover, the Shilling plays a critical role in international trade, particularly for Kenya's exports such as tea, coffee, and horticultural products. A steady exchange rate is vital for maintaining competitive export prices and attracting foreign investments.

The Central Bank of Kenya is the key entity responsible for managing the Kenyan Shilling. It implements monetary policies aimed at maintaining currency stability and controlling inflation. These policies are essential for fostering a favorable economic environment, encouraging investment, and ensuring the currency's role as a reliable medium of exchange. The central bank's role in preserving the stability of the Shilling is a testament to the importance of the currency in the financial and economic landscape of Kenya.

Beyond the domestic economic scene, the Kenyan Shilling also plays a role in the global financial market. Remittances from Kenyans living abroad, particularly in North America and Europe, contribute significantly to the national economy. These funds, exchanged for Shillings, support many families and constitute a significant source of foreign income for the country.

The design of the Kenyan Shilling also holds significant cultural and historical value. Banknotes and coins feature images of Kenya's founding father, Jomo Kenyatta, and later Mzee Jomo Kenyatta, along with other prominent figures. They also showcase various wildlife species, reflecting Kenya's commitment to preserving its natural and cultural heritage. This design symbolism serves as a constant reminder of the nation's rich past and its aspirations for the future.

Why Do Exchange Rates Fluctuate?

Exchange rates move due to supply and demand in the global market. Key drivers include:
  • Interest Rates: Central banks raising or lowering rates influence investor behavior.
  • Inflation: Lower inflation helps a currency hold its value.
  • Economic Indicators: Data like GDP growth, employment, and trade balance impact confidence.
  • Market Sentiment: News, policy changes, or political shifts can trigger rapid changes.

Why This Matters

Since CATI is typically valued in USD, shifts in KES vs USD affect the CATI to KES rate.
  • A stronger KES means you will pay less to get the same amount of CATI.
  • A weaker KES means you will pay more, even if the crypto's USD price did not change.
